this position Summary: The Postpartum Registered Nurse provides
specialized, family-centered care to mothers and newborns in the
postpartum unit. This role involves assessing maternal and newborn
health, implementing care plans, and supports breastfeeding and
educating families on postpartum and newborn care. The Postpartum
RN collaborates with healthcare teams to ensure optimal outcomes
and demonstrates advanced clinical skills, critical thinking, and a
commitment to patient safety and professional ethics. Essential
Work Functions: Explain postpartum and newborn care procedures to
mothers and families to gain cooperation, understanding, and
alleviate apprehension Administer prescribed medications and
treatments to mothers and newborns safely and accurately, following
established protocols Assess and monitor the health of postpartum
mothers and newborns, identifying changes, addressing
complications, and recording significant conditions and reactions
Assist with and educate on breastfeeding, addressing challenges to
ensure successful feeding practices Perform newborn assessments,
including vital signs, weight checks, and required screening tests
Respond to life-saving situations using evidence-based protocols
and best practices Collaborate with interdisciplinary teams Educate
new parents on infant care, maternal recovery, and postpartum
health, including safe sleep practices and early signs of
complications Prepare equipment and aid physicians during
examinations and any necessary postpartum or neonatal procedures
Maintain awareness of comfort and safety needs of mothers and
newborns, ensuring a safe, supportive environment for bonding
Document all relevant history and physical assessments for assigned
patients accurately in medical records Perform other duties as
assignment within the scope of the practice Required Essential
